21 lines
462 B
YAML
21 lines
462 B
YAML
- name: Add apt repo key
|
|
become: yes
|
|
apt_key:
|
|
data: "{{ repo_key }}"
|
|
keyring: "/etc/apt/trusted.gpg.d/{{ repo_name }}.gpg"
|
|
|
|
- name: Add apt repo
|
|
become: yes
|
|
copy:
|
|
dest: "/etc/apt/sources.list.d/{{ repo_name }}.list"
|
|
group: root
|
|
owner: root
|
|
mode: 0644
|
|
content: "{{ repo_content }}"
|
|
register: apt_repo
|
|
|
|
- name: Run the equivalent of "apt-get update" as a separate step
|
|
apt:
|
|
update_cache: yes
|
|
when: apt_repo is changed
|